collector

Pronunciation:/kəˈlɛktə(ɹ)//kəˈlɛktɚ/

noun

Definitions

  1. A person who or thing that collects, or which creates or manages a collection.

    Example: He is an avid collector of nineteenth-century postage stamps.

  2. A person who is employed to collect payments.

    Example: She works for the government as a tax collector.

  3. The amplified terminal on a bipolar junction transistor.

  4. A compiler of books; one who collects scattered passages and puts them together in one book.
